Gana (played by Sriimurali) is a protagonist in Mufti.
An undercover police officer posing as an assassin to infiltrate Bhairathi Ranagal's syndicate in Ronapura. Initially tasked with gathering evidence, he becomes conflicted after witnessing Bhairathi's charitable deeds and surviving multiple assassination attempts. He ultimately helps expose the true mastermind behind the attacks, leads to Bhairathi's surrender, and is promoted to Superintendent of Police. Bhairathi Ranagal (played by Shiva Rajkumar) is a protagonist in Mufti.
A former lawyer turned village crime boss who secretly finances orphanages, schools, and housing using illicit funds. He fiercely protects Ronapura from external political threats and corrupt officials, eliminating betrayers and framing his enemies while maintaining a brutal reputation. Ultimately surrenders to the law after recognizing the protagonist's integrity. Vedhavathi (played by Chaya Singh) appears in Mufti.
Bhairathi's sister who initially holds a grudge against him for murdering her first husband. She later discovers the truth that he killed him to stop a fatal medical scam, leading to a reconciliation orchestrated by Gana. Kashi (played by Vasishta N. Simha) appears in Mufti.
The head of Bhairathi's cement company who grows suspicious and jealous of Gana. He attempts to test Gana by forcing him to execute a corrupt cop, but Gana ultimately turns the tables, kills Kashi, and frames him for conspiring with political rivals. Singa (played by Madhu Guruswamy) appears in Mufti.
Bhairathi's trusted right-hand man who initially welcomes Gana into the syndicate. He later becomes pivotal in revealing Bhairathi's past motives to Vedhavathi through a conversation overheard by her, helping clarify the clan's internal history. Raghuveer Bhandri (played by Devaraj) appears in Mufti.
A corrupt politician and brother of a chief ministerial candidate who secretly orchestrates violent attacks against Bhairathi and political rivals. He bribes gang members, stages a fatal car explosion, and ultimately meets his end during a violent confrontation at a graveyard.
